Military:

In June of 1980 I entered the navy through Boot Camp San Diego, under the navy’s nuclear power program as an Electrician’s Mate, qualified as an Engineering Watch Supervisor, Navy/Ships Diver and Assistant Corpsman.  Pursued a bachelors’ degree at night in Manufacturing Engineering.  Accepted to AOCS and commissioned as an Ensign Jun 1990. In July 1996 attended Naval Postgraduate School, Monterey, California, earning the degree of Master of Science in Personnel Management.  Awards include Meritorious Service Medal, Navy Commendation Medal (w/Combat “V”), Navy Achievement Medal (2), Good Conduct (2), Battle “E” (5), Expert Pistol, and various theater and unit awards.  Retired as a Lieutenant Commander in February 2007.

The better part of 2007 / 8, I was contracted to create curriculum and scenario for the ‘Capstone’ of the Navy War College’s Maritime Staff Operators Course.
